1. Slim Jim
A slim jim can be used to open the car door without a key. Locksmiths employ it because it's simple and lets them unlock numerous cars quickly. This technique can harm your vehicle if not done correctly. This is why it is crucial to consult a professional to ensure that you do not cause damage to your vehicle.
The slim jim is a metal strip with a notch at one end. It is placed in the space between the window and the weather stripping is able to latch to the rods that connect to the locking mechanism. The locksmith is able to open the vehicle without removing the window. In certain situations, it may even be faster than using a key or lockpick.
This tool isn't just employed by lock technicians who are professionals but is also employed by thieves who are able to break into vehicles. Depending on the skill of the criminal, this can be successful or cause the thief to disconnect the rods and make the lock inoperable. The good news is that the modern locks come with built-in protections against this type of attack.

4. Wedge Tool
One of the most popular methods used by locksmiths to open cars is by wedgeing the door open. This technique involves slowly creating a gap between the frame and the window of the door by using an inflatable wedge tool. This allows the locksmith lost car keys cost to place an extended reach or pry bar within the car to work on gaining access. It also allows them to protect the vehicle from damage and its body.
